Well... after a few hours, almost all my media keys restarted to work...
Only one is still not working... the stop/eject key...
which was keycode 164 (mapped to key <I24> in xkb/keycodes/xfree86)
and seems to be now keycode 232 (mapped to key <I68> in same file)...
I don't know if it's a Xubuntu/xmodmap/whatever kernel issue but it's
really random and boring !
But even with rebind of the key in xkb... nothing change.... I can use
the settings manager to create the keyboards shortcuts but nothing work
with this only key...
nothing seems weird in my xmodmap
but in xev, pressing the stop key display :
KeyPress event, serial 31, synthetic NO, window 0x2c00001,
root 0x5a, subw 0x2c00002, time 70969032, (29,44), root:(580,351),
state 0x0, keycode 232 (keysym 0x1008ff15, XF86AudioStop), same_screen YES,
XKeysymToKeycode returns keycode: 164
XLookupString gives 0 bytes:
XmbLookupString gives 0 bytes:
XFilterEvent returns: False
which metion 164 and 232 keycodes... but nothing about XKeysymToKeycode
that I can parametrize...
